| Where did this happen? (City, County, State) | Blacksburg, VA; Radford University; Virginia Tech, elsewhere |
| What voters would be affected? | College students |
| How would tactic suppress votes? | Threat of loss of dependency status on parents tax returns. |
| Who is behind it? | State registrar and others. |

| What's the last known status? | Unclear. The Brennan Center for Justice. The center, along with the ACLU of Virginia, sent a letter detailing these complaints at the end of September, and threatening legal action if the students applications are not cleared. |
| What actions can be taken? | Report incidents to the ACLU of Virginia |
